admin 管理员组

文章数量: 1086019


2024年5月31日发(作者:苹果开发的软件有哪些)

编程逻辑基础教程

在当今数字化快速发展的时代,编程技能已成为一个越来越重要的

技能。无论是从事软件开发、数据分析还是智能科技等领域,具备良

好的编程逻辑是成功的关键之一。本篇文章将介绍编程逻辑的基础知

识和常见的编程思维方法,帮助读者快速入门并掌握编程逻辑。

一、什么是编程逻辑

编程逻辑是指在编写计算机程序时所需的思维和方法论。它用于规

划并指导解决问题的步骤和顺序,确保程序能够按照预期的方式运行。

编程逻辑通常涉及以下几个方面:

1. 算法思维:算法是解决问题的一组清晰而有序的步骤。编程逻辑

需要具备良好的算法思维,即能够分解问题、确定解决方案并设计相

应的计算机程序。

2. 顺序结构:程序按照指定的顺序执行,每一条指令都会按照先后

顺序被计算机执行。编程逻辑需要合理规划程序的逻辑流程,确保程

序按照正确的顺序执行。

3. 条件判断:程序在执行过程中可能需要根据某些条件来进行不同

的处理。编程逻辑需要使用条件判断语句,帮助程序根据不同的情况

作出相应的决策。

4. 循环结构:在某些情况下,程序需要重复执行一段代码。编程逻

辑需要善于使用循环语句,帮助程序反复执行相同或类似的操作,提

高效率和灵活性。

二、编程逻辑的基本原则

要想编写出高效、可读性强的程序,遵循一些基本的编程逻辑原则

是必不可少的。以下是几个常见的原则:

1. 模块化:将程序划分为一个个独立的模块,每个模块负责实现特

定的功能。模块化的设计可以提高程序的可读性和可维护性,同时也

方便多人协作开发。

2. 抽象化:将复杂的问题简化成易于理解和处理的形式。通过抽象

化,可以将问题分解成更小的子问题,从而更好地理解问题的本质并

设计相应的解决方案。

3. 逻辑复用:将重复出现的逻辑过程封装成函数或方法,在不同的

场景中重复利用。逻辑复用可以提高代码的重用性和可维护性,避免

出现重复编写相同逻辑的情况。

4. 错误处理:合理处理程序中可能出现的错误和异常情况。编程逻

辑需要在代码中加入适当的错误处理机制,以保证程序的健壮性和稳

定性。

三、编程逻辑示例

以下是一个简单的编程逻辑示例,用来计算给定数组中所有元素的

平均值:

```python

def calculate_average(nums):

total = 0

count = len(nums)

for num in nums:

total += num

average = total / count

return average

numbers = [1, 2, 3, 4, 5]

result = calculate_average(numbers)

print(result)

```

在这个示例中,我们定义了一个名为`calculate_average`的函数,它

接受一个整数数组作为参数,并通过遍历数组来计算数组中所有元素

的总和。最后,通过总和除以数组的长度,得到平均值,并将其作为

函数的返回值。

这个示例展示了顺序结构、循环结构和算法思维的应用。通过学习

这种示例并结合不同的编程语言,读者可以更深入地理解编程逻辑的

应用。

结论

编程逻辑是每个程序员都需要掌握的基本技能之一。它不仅仅是一

种思维模式,更是一种方法论和工具,用于解决复杂的问题和实现创

新的想法。通过了解编程逻辑的基本原理和常用方法,读者可以更好

地理解计算机程序的运行原理,并能够编写出高效、可读性强的代码。

希望本篇文章对读者在编程逻辑的学习和实践中起到一定的帮助。


本文标签: 逻辑 编程 程序